The Indian Olympic Association’s (IOA) decision to appoint Bollywood’s superstar Salman Khan as the ambassador to represent the country in the upcoming Rio Olympic Games (2016) has got mixed response from masses. While ace athletes like Mary Kom state that it would be good for sports that a personality like Salman Khan who enjoys immense star power supports sports, its a great thing. But this has not gone down well with other sports persons. 2012 London Olympics bronze medalist Yogeshwar Dutt made his displeasure pretty obvious through his tweets. Legendary athlete Milkha Singh joined him and SLAMMED IOA for their decision.

He stated that instead of a Bollywood celeb, a sportsperson should be given this honour. In his debate he also asked if Bollywood would make a sportsperson their brand ambassador for their international event? Though he said that he has nothing personal about Salman, he would like if the association replaces him with a more deserving candidate.

While the opinion of the fraternity stands DIVIDED over Salman’s appointment, the association maintains that they are happy that Salman has volunteered to support sports. They also maintained that there was no monetary exchange involved in this appointment and that they cherish the Sultan star’s efforts to work for sports.
